Lines of credit
A business line of credit functions like a credit card for your company: you receive approval for a maximum amount, withdraw funds as required, pay interest only on what you use, and replenish the line as you repay. Mission businesses benefit because revolving credit adapts to fluctuating cash needs without the delay of applying for a new term loan every quarter.
